As a ML Engineer at Axon, you will contribute to architecting and implementing the platform used by Axon scientists to bring safe, secure, reliable AI features to Axon devices. Collaborating closely with scientists and device engineers, you will enable new AI capabilities for Axon products (Fleet, Axon Body, Axon Air, and more). You will also make sure As part of a multidisciplinary team, you will be exposed to a wide range of domains and applications: from Automatic License Plates Recognition to Object Tracking and Automatic Speech Recognition.
Job Responsibility:
Architect and develop secure, privacy-preserving, on device solutions to enable the continuous improvement of existing AI models
Collaborate with scientists in architecting and implementing state-of-the-art edge distributed training techniques
Implement on device monitoring solutions used for continuous model improvement
Implement innovative model compression solutions to enable AI at the edge
Impact the team by bringing your own expertise and deep knowledge of the state-of-the-art to introduce new techniques leading to tangible impact in terms of model fairness, performance, and platform scalability
Requirements:
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Physics, Mathematics or an equivalent highly technical field
10+ years of software engineering experience and a proven track record of successfully architecting and maintaining large-scale distributed platforms
Experience with AI on chips, on device model deployment and management
Proficiency in python, C++, familiarity with ML frameworks such as TensorFlow, or PyTorch
Advanced knowledge and hands-on experience with on chips development
Excellent problem solving skills and ability to dive into system architecture, design, performance metrics, code, test plans, project plans, deployments and operations
Comfort communicating and interacting with scientists, engineers and product managers
Nice to have:
Master’s Deg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Physics, Mathematics or an equivalent highly technical field
Hands-on experience in solving Computer Vision or Natural Language Understanding problems in a business setting
Familiarity with responsible AI, de-biasing, model encryption and de-identification techniques
